Super Splash Heroes assembly
Pupils from Years 1, 2, 3 and 4 were lucky to be visited by the Super Splash Heroes from Essex and Suffolk Water. The came in to give us an enjoyable and informative show on how we can save water and the important reasons for doing so. I am sure that they will be coming home with some helpful suggestions about water conservation!

Year 6 Bikeability
In recent weeks, our Year 6 children have taken part in Bikeability. The children were able to learn about riding their bikes on the road and the safety precautions to take when doing so. They were led by instructors who taught them key skills for riding a bike. Others continued their learning in the playground and had a thoroughly fun time improving their skills.

Netball vs. Bournemouth Park
Yesterday the Friars Netball Team played against Bournemouth Park. It went quite well in the first half and Friars were doing very well but then Bournemouth Park started to score. Although we lost 4-2 our team played very well for their first Netball match. Report by Freya

Essex Fire and Rescue Service
Stuart from Essex Fire and Rescue Service came to school on Friday in order to tell us some important safety advice in the build up to Firework Night and Halloween. The children were told important information for trick or treating and how to be safe with fireworks and sparklers.
The Firework Code offers advice for adults and children.
Firework Code
• Only buy fireworks marked BS 7114.
• Don’t drink alcohol if setting off fireworks.
• Keep fireworks in a closed box.
